What does a Bluetooth amplifier do?

With a Bluetooth amp you can knock out two birds with one stone. You’ll add the convenience of wireless Bluetooth streaming to your car while also amplifying your existing system. Some Bluetooth amps also include a wired microphone, enabling hands-free phone calls.

Can old speakers be made wireless?

Traditionally wired speakers don’t have a built-in amplifier and cannot receive audio signals wirelessly. Still, you can make them “wireless” with the use of add-on devices.

How can I use a car amp without a head unit?

If you want an iPod car adapter that will bypass your head unit and actually work, then you need to have an amplifier somewhere in the equation. The easiest way to accomplish this is to just install a power amp that has RCA inputs. You can then use a 3.5mm TRS to RCA cable to connect your iPod or phone to the amp.

What does audio amplifier do?

The goal of audio amplifiers is to reproduce input audio signals at sound-producing output elements, with desired volume and power levels—faithfully, efficiently, and at low distortion.

Can you add Bluetooth to a car that doesn’t have it?

One of the best ways to add Bluetooth to your vehicle is by getting an FM transmitter. It comes in handy when your car’s radio doesn’t have an auxiliary input. The FM transmitter broadcasts audio over an open FM radio frequency, but you have to tune your stereo to the right frequency so that you can hear the audio.

How can I Bluetooth my car without aux?

If your car or radio doesn’t have an auxiliary input, you’ll be better off with an FM transmitter. Effectively, the FM transmitter of today is a Bluetooth receiver, but instead of sending the audio to the stereo via an auxiliary cable, it broadcasts it over an open FM radio frequency.

What kind of amplifier do I need for my car stereo?

Generally, amplifiers for your car stereo are categorized by the number of channels they’re designed to power. A mono, or one-channel, amplifier can power a single speaker, and is often used to add a subwoofer.

Why do you need an amp in your car?

External car audio amps boost electric signals, increasing the power to the car radio, CD player or other inputs, as well as the speakers, improving the overall power and quality of your in-vehicle audio. For folks who want music to be loud and pristine, a car stereo amp should definitely be a part of the picture.
